3. What to Pack

While preparing for your tour, it’s essential to pack appropriately. Here are some recommended items:

  • Comfortable walking shoes
  • Weather-appropriate clothing
  • Sunscreen and sunglasses
  • Camera or smartphone with enough storage space
  • Bottled water and snacks
  • Umbrella or raincoat (depending on the weather forecast)

5.4 Follow Local Customs

Respect the local customs and etiquette when visiting temples and shrines. Remove your shoes when entering certain areas, dress modestly, and refrain from loud conversations or disruptive behavior.
